Home
last modified time | relevance | path

Searched refs:InputCount (Results 1 – 25 of 29) sorted by relevance

12

/art/compiler/optimizing/
Dconstructor_fence_redundancy_elimination.cc49 for (size_t input_idx = 0; input_idx < constructor_fence->InputCount(); ++input_idx) { in VisitConstructorFence()
176 for (size_t input_count = 0; input_count < inst->InputCount(); ++input_count) { in HasInterestingPublishTargetAsInput()
203 << merge_target->InputCount(); in MergeCandidateFences()
Dloop_optimization_test.cc236 for (size_t i = 0, e = phi->InputCount(); i < e; i++) { in TEST_F()
311 EXPECT_EQ(new_preheader_phi->InputCount(), 2u); in TEST_F()
315 EXPECT_EQ(header_phi->InputCount(), 2u); in TEST_F()
Dlocations.cc33 : inputs_(instruction->InputCount(), allocator->Adapter(kArenaAllocLocationSummary)), in LocationSummary()
Dcommon_arm.h140 DCHECK_EQ(instr->InputCount(), 1u); in InputVRegister()
154 DCHECK_EQ(instr->InputCount(), 1u); in InputRegister()
Dsuperblock_cloner.cc65 for (size_t i = 1, e = phi->InputCount(); i < e; i++) { in ArePhiInputsTheSame()
118 for (size_t i = 0, e = copy_instr->InputCount(); i < e; i++) { in ReplaceInputsWithCopies()
187 phi_input_count = copy_phi->InputCount(); in RemapOrigInternalOrIncomingEdge()
190 DCHECK_EQ(phi_input_count, copy_phi->InputCount()); in RemapOrigInternalOrIncomingEdge()
394 for (size_t i = 0, e = phi->InputCount(); i < e; i++) { in ResolvePhi()
674 for (size_t i = 0, e = orig_instr->InputCount(); i < e; i++) { in CheckInstructionInputsRemapping()
Ddead_code_elimination.cc349 for (size_t i = 0; i < phi->InputCount();) { in SimplifyIfs()
385 if (phi->InputCount() == 1) { in SimplifyIfs()
Dprepare_for_register_allocation.cc223 DCHECK_EQ(1u, constructor_fence->InputCount()); in VisitConstructorFence()
Dsuperblock_cloner_test.cc186 EXPECT_EQ(orig_instr->InputCount(), copy_instr->InputCount()); in TEST_F()
189 for (size_t i = 0, e = orig_instr->InputCount(); i < e; i++) { in TEST_F()
Dssa_builder.cc437 HInstruction* str = invoke->InputAt(invoke->InputCount() - 1); in ReplaceUninitializedStringPhis()
448 invoke->RemoveInputAt(invoke->InputCount() - 1); in ReplaceUninitializedStringPhis()
Dinduction_var_analysis.cc708 if (phi->IsLoopHeaderPhi() && phi->InputCount() == 2) { in SolvePhiAllInputs()
750 if (x == entry_phi && entry_phi->InputCount() == 2 && instruction == entry_phi->InputAt(1)) { in SolveAddSub()
769 if (y == entry_phi && entry_phi->InputCount() == 2 && instruction == entry_phi->InputAt(1)) { in SolveAddSub()
792 if (entry_phi->InputCount() == 2 && instruction == entry_phi->InputAt(1)) { in SolveOp()
870 if (entry_phi->InputCount() == 2 && conversion == entry_phi->InputAt(1)) { in SolveConversion()
Dcode_sinking.cc72 DCHECK_NE(0u, ctor_fence->InputCount()); in IsInterestingInstruction()
Dnodes.cc492 input_pos < header_phi->InputCount(); in TransformLoopToSinglePreheaderFormat()
1385 DCHECK_EQ(0u, InputCount()); in RemoveAllInputs()
1441 if (ctor_fence->InputCount() == 0u) { in RemoveConstructorFences()
1472 for (size_t input_count = 0; input_count < haystack->InputCount(); ++input_count) { in Merge()
1481 for (size_t input_count = 0; input_count < other->InputCount(); ++input_count) { in Merge()
1508 if (InputCount() == 1u && InputAt(0) == new_instance_inst) { in GetAssociatedAllocation()
1789 DCHECK_EQ(InputCount(), 0u); in MoveBeforeFirstUserAndOutOfLoops()
2634 size_t last_input_index = invoke->InputCount() - 1; in InlineInto()
Dcode_generator.cc731 DCHECK_EQ(cls->InputCount(), 1u); in CreateLoadClassRuntimeCallLocationSummary()
757 DCHECK_EQ(method_handle->InputCount(), 1u); in CreateLoadMethodHandleRuntimeCallLocationSummary()
777 DCHECK_EQ(method_type->InputCount(), 1u); in CreateLoadMethodTypeRuntimeCallLocationSummary()
Dcode_generator_vector_arm_vixl.cc745 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
766 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
Dcode_generator_vector_x86.cc1008 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
1046 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
Dcode_generator_vector_x86_64.cc991 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
1024 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
Dcode_generator_vector_mips64.cc941 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
974 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
Dcode_generator_vector_mips.cc942 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
975 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
Dnodes_vector.h174 instruction->InputCount() == 2 && in ReturnsSIMDValue()
Dgraph_checker.cc849 size_t input_count_next = next_phi->InputCount(); in VisitPhi()
Dcode_generator_vector_arm64.cc969 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
1002 DCHECK_EQ(1u, instruction->InputCount()); // only one input currently implemented in VisitVecSetScalars()
Dnodes.h2083 size_t InputCount() const { return GetInputRecords().size(); } in InputCount() function
3307 return InputCount() == 2; in GuardsAnInput()
4604 DCHECK(InputCount() == GetSpecialInputIndex() || in AddSpecialInput()
4605 (InputCount() == GetSpecialInputIndex() + 1 && IsStaticWithExplicitClinitCheck())); in AddSpecialInput()
4644 bool HasSpecialInput() const { return GetNumberOfArguments() != InputCount(); } in HasSpecialInput()
4663 DCHECK(InputCount() == GetSpecialInputIndex() || in HasCurrentMethodInput()
Dcode_generator_x86.cc4817 DCHECK_EQ(invoke->InputCount(), invoke->GetNumberOfArguments() + 1u); in GetInvokeStaticOrDirectExtraParameter()
4951 DCHECK_EQ(invoke->InputCount(), invoke->GetNumberOfArguments() + 1u); in RecordBootImageMethodPatch()
4960 DCHECK_EQ(invoke->InputCount(), invoke->GetNumberOfArguments() + 1u); in RecordMethodBssEntryPatch()
5005 DCHECK_EQ(invoke->InputCount(), invoke->GetNumberOfArguments() + 1u); in LoadBootImageAddress()
5014 DCHECK_EQ(invoke->InputCount(), invoke->GetNumberOfArguments() + 1u); in LoadBootImageAddress()
5039 DCHECK_EQ(invoke->InputCount(), invoke->GetNumberOfArguments() + 1u); in AllocateInstanceForIntrinsic()
Dinliner.cc917 DCHECK_EQ(deopt_flag->InputCount(), 1u); in AddCHAGuard()
Dintrinsics_x86.cc3018 DCHECK_EQ(invoke->InputCount(), invoke->GetNumberOfArguments() + 1u); in VisitIntegerValueOf()

12